Step 1: Inspection and Assessment

Our technicians will inspect your hardwood floors to find out the extent of the damage. We’ll look for signs of warping, cupping, and water stains, and we’ll use specialized equipment to measure the moisture levels in your floors. This is crucial in determining the right course of action and preventing further damage.

Warning Signs You Need Hardwood Floor Water Damage Repair

Catching water damage early saves you money and prevents bigger problems down the line. Here are some warning signs to look out for:

Musty Odors That Won’t Go Away

Strong, musty odors that linger long after a spill or leak can be a sign of water damage on your hardwood floors. This can lead to health risks, so don’t ignore it.

Warped or Cupped Boards

Warped or cupped boards can be a sign of water damage on your hardwood floors. If left unchecked, this can lead to further damage and costly repairs.

Water Stains on Your Floors

Water stains on your hardwood floors can be a sign of water damage. These stains can spread and become more difficult to clean, so don’t wait.

Soft or Spongy Boards

Soft or spongy boards can be a sign of water damage on your hardwood floors. This can lead to further damage and costly repairs, so don’t ignore it.

Buckled or Raised Boards

Buckled or raised boards can be a sign of water damage on your hardwood floors. This can lead to further damage and costly repairs, so don’t wait.

Hardwood Floor Water Damage Repair Cost in Kachina Village, AZ

The cost of hardwood floor water damage repair can vary depending on the severity of the damage, the size of the affected area, and local conditions in Kachina Village, AZ. These are estimates, not guarantees. Here’s a rough breakdown of what you might expect to pay:

Service Typical Price Range What Affects Cost
Initial Inspection and Assessment $100 – $500 Severity of damage, size of affected area, local conditions
Water Extraction and Drying $500 – $2,500 Severity of damage, size of affected area, local conditions
Repair and Restoration $1,000 – $5,000 Severity of damage, size of affected area, local conditions, type of repair needed
Final Inspection and Touch-ups $100 – $500 Severity of damage, size of affected area, local conditions
Insurance Claim Handling $100 – $500 Severity of damage, size of affected area, local conditions, complexity of claim

Q: What’s the difference between water extraction and drying?

A: Water extraction and drying are two separate steps in the repair process. Water extraction involves removing excess water from the affected area, while drying involves using specialized equipment to dry the area completely.
